Searched refs:BroadcastVT (Results 1 – 2 of 2) sorted by relevance
10986 MVT BroadcastVT = VT; in lowerVectorShuffleAsBroadcast() local11002 BroadcastVT = MVT::getVectorVT(MVT::f64, VT.getVectorNumElements()); in lowerVectorShuffleAsBroadcast()11003 Opcode = (BroadcastVT.is128BitVector() && !Subtarget.hasAVX2()) in lowerVectorShuffleAsBroadcast()11012 EVT SVT = BroadcastVT.getScalarType(); in lowerVectorShuffleAsBroadcast()11041 assert(V.getScalarValueSizeInBits() == BroadcastVT.getScalarSizeInBits() && in lowerVectorShuffleAsBroadcast()11054 if (SrcVT.getScalarType() != BroadcastVT.getScalarType()) { in lowerVectorShuffleAsBroadcast()11055 assert(SrcVT.getScalarSizeInBits() == BroadcastVT.getScalarSizeInBits() && in lowerVectorShuffleAsBroadcast()11059 SrcVT = MVT::getVectorVT(BroadcastVT.getScalarType(), NumSrcElts); in lowerVectorShuffleAsBroadcast()11061 SrcVT = BroadcastVT.getScalarType(); in lowerVectorShuffleAsBroadcast()11069 unsigned NumBroadcastElts = BroadcastVT.getVectorNumElements(); in lowerVectorShuffleAsBroadcast()[all …]
8618 MVT BroadcastVT = VT; in lowerVectorShuffleAsBroadcast() local8634 BroadcastVT = MVT::getVectorVT(MVT::f64, VT.getVectorNumElements()); in lowerVectorShuffleAsBroadcast()8635 Opcode = (BroadcastVT.is128BitVector() ? X86ISD::MOVDDUP : Opcode); in lowerVectorShuffleAsBroadcast()8642 EVT SVT = BroadcastVT.getScalarType(); in lowerVectorShuffleAsBroadcast()8678 if (SrcVT.getScalarType() != BroadcastVT.getScalarType()) { in lowerVectorShuffleAsBroadcast()8679 assert(SrcVT.getScalarSizeInBits() == BroadcastVT.getScalarSizeInBits() && in lowerVectorShuffleAsBroadcast()8683 SrcVT = MVT::getVectorVT(BroadcastVT.getScalarType(), NumSrcElts); in lowerVectorShuffleAsBroadcast()8685 SrcVT = BroadcastVT.getScalarType(); in lowerVectorShuffleAsBroadcast()8690 return DAG.getBitcast(VT, DAG.getNode(Opcode, DL, BroadcastVT, V)); in lowerVectorShuffleAsBroadcast()